▲点击上方关注STM32
步履不停,进阶不止,STM32 GUI开发系列课程新课上线啦!
本次上线的新课《STM32 GUI开发技能分享》,是《STM32 & X-Cube-TouchGFX GUI开发实践》系列课程的第7章节。该章节内容将分享STM32 GUI的开发技能,帮助大家迅速掌握开发技巧,加快开发速度,创造出更多界面友好美观的嵌入式产品。

“颜值即正义”这一理念已被广大用户接受,颜值高的嵌入式产品会提升产品竞争力。而嵌入式产品的颜值取决于用户界面是否美观、人机交互是否友好,以及界面切换流畅度等等。那么如何做好 GUI 开发呢?TouchGFX 会是你的好帮手!
TouchGFX是ST力推的GUI应用软件,可实现从简单到可与智能手机媲美的GUI设计,具备针对STM32优化的GUI库,采用C++语言编程,支持1/2/4/16和24 bpp,具有可生成完整代码的GUI构建器。目前,TouchGFX已完全集成在STM32CubeMX中。TouchGFX 可快速启动并实现高端GUI所需的一切,在STM32上实现与智能手机相媲美的GUI性能。课程介绍
《STM32 & X-Cube-TouchGFX GUI开发实践》线上课程是ST专为帮助开发者快速了解 GUI 开发知识、深入掌握 GUI 进阶技巧而打造,针对使用STM32高性能产品的开发人员和高校师生,尤其是对STM32 GUI开发感兴趣的工程师。课程自2020年上线以来,通过对 STM32 GUI 平台化方案的介绍和解读,为很多开发者提供了全新的设计理念和顺手的开发工具,极大地拉低了嵌入式产品 GUI 开发的门槛。
《STM32 & X-Cube-TouchGFX GUI开发实践》课程分为两大模块:理论知识与开发实践。上半部(第1章、第2章、第3章)的理论知识从 X-Cube-TouchGFX 方案介绍、快速上手、框架介绍三大维度带大家破冰入门 GUI 开发、快速上手学习路径,以及解析 STM32 + X-Cube-TouchGFX 开发平台的优点。
下半部(第4章、第5章、第6章*)的开发实践帮助工程师快速熟悉STM32 + X-Cube-TouchGFX的开发流程, 以及掌握在不同MCU/LCD拓扑结构下如何进行GUI开发。通过动手实践,快速从了解到掌握,然后创造出更多界面友好美观的嵌入式产品。
*第6章课程内容优化中,将于近期上线从入门到进阶,从原理到实战,从想学习无从下手到多实践融会贯通,《STM32 & X-Cube-TouchGFX GUI开发实践》专栏课程 360 度手把手教你做出高级感拉满的 GUI 作品。
本次上线的新课是第7章,将分享STM32 GUI的开发技能,帮助大家迅速掌握开发技巧,加快开发速度,创造出更多界面友好美观的嵌入式产品。

课程目录STM32GUI开发技能分享(一)
-
撕裂优化(LTDC FIFO UNDERRUN)
-
TouchGFX 非内存映射存储
-
TouchGFX 控件计时
STM32 GUI开发技能分享(二)
-
TouchGFX动态显示中文
-
如何快速导入导出多语言文本
- TouchGFX Designer模拟器自定义皮肤的设置方法

THE END

长按扫码关注公众号
更多资讯,尽在STM32
点击“阅读原文,订阅《STM32 & X-Cube-TouchGFX GUI开发实践》系列课程。
原文标题:GUI系列课程上新 | STM32 GUI开发技能分享
文章出处:【微信公众号:STM32单片机】欢迎添加关注!文章转载请注明出处。
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。
举报投诉
-
单片机
+关注
关注
6078文章
45629浏览量
675328 -
STM32
+关注
关注
2313文章
11206浏览量
375226
原文标题:GUI系列课程上新 | STM32 GUI开发技能分享
文章出处:【微信号:STM32_STM8_MCU,微信公众号:STM32单片机】欢迎添加关注!文章转载请注明出处。
发布评论请先 登录
相关推荐
热点推荐
EsDA科普 | AWTK:打造流畅、开源、跨平台的嵌入式GUI
工业GUI开发四大坑:界面卡、启动慢、跨平台难、版权贵。AWTK用纯C语言+自研算法破局,一套代码跑遍全平台,100%开源免费,拖拽即得工业级交互界面。你的GUI开发是否遇到这些坑?在
请问如何在 Debian 上设置 GUI?
我已经设置了我的 VisionFive 2,更新了固件和完整的 Debian Image 69。但是,HDMI 输出只是黑屏。如何设置 GUI?
发表于 03-24 06:35
在GUI GUIDER中如何启用eSingle Buffer
在嵌入式 GUI 开发中,“跑不快”“卡顿”“撕裂”几乎是所有工程师都踩过的坑。尤其是在 RGB LCD 这种持续扫描的显示接口下,当显存刷新与 LCD 扫描不同步时,画面撕裂几乎不可避免。为了规避
恩智浦嵌入式HMI应用开发工具GUI Guider 1.10.1全新上线
恩智浦嵌入式HMI应用开发工具GUI Guider 1.10.1全新上线啦!新版本重点聚焦性能提升、工具链升级、多点触控体验以及开发板适配,进一步优化IDE界面,增强功能稳定性,并完善文档体系。
【课程升级】鸿蒙星闪WS63开发板新增《LVGL应用开发指南》课程,带屏开发让你的毕设项目更出彩!
好消息,华清远见鸿蒙星闪WS63开发板配套课程升级通知!本次升级计划,专为星闪带屏开发用户打造,从入门到精通,助力开发者使用LVGL(一款开源的轻量级嵌入式
恩智浦GUI Guider 1.10.0正式上线
GUI Guider 1.10.0正式上线啦!新版本软件带来了更智能的UI开发工具、更高效的图片资源性能优化,以及更广泛的开发板支持。
基于兆易创新GD32系列MCU的GUI智能屏显解决方案
随着人机交互需求的不断提升,图形用户界面(GUI)已成为各类智能设备的核心组成部分。兆易创新GD32系列MCU凭借其丰富的外设接口和强大的处理能力,为用户们提供了全面的GUI屏显解决方案,从低功耗小型显示屏到高分辨率彩色触摸屏,
GUI Guider全新优化方案GUI xTurbo-VeloRender初体验:基于i.MX RT平台的LVGL渲染能力突破
引言 在嵌入式GUI开发领域,图形界面的渲染性能直接决定了用户体验的流畅度与产品竞争力。针对i.MX RT系列的开发需求,恩智浦在2025年隆重推出全新的性能优化方案 -
【PCA9958HN-ARD】GUI工具的使用
一、说明
PCA9958HN-ARD评估板是可以通过NXP官方的GUI上位机来进行控制的,但是需要使用另外的官方指定的MCU开发板。
例如下图就是通过LPC55S69-EVKMCU板来演示
发表于 06-29 10:07
10分钟上手睿擎平台GUI开发:第一个LVGL图形应用
LVGL开源图形库为嵌入式系统提供了高效的GUI设计解决方案,为开发者提供了直观且易于使用的界面设计环境。LVGL不仅资源占用低,更拥有全面的功能和丰富的文档资料,使得GUI设计变得简单而高效。此外
瑞芯微RK3506(3核A7@1.5GHz+双网口+双CAN-FD)工业开发板—图形用户界面(GUI)开发手册
本文主要说明Qt的图形用户界面(GUI)开发流程,包括Qt程序自启动配置与案例介绍,旨在帮助开发者完成产品开发与测试。
GUI系列课程上新 | STM32 GUI开发技能分享
评论